From apprenticeship to in-house service engineer
Nicklas’s journey at CORE-emt
Throughout his apprenticeship at CORE-emt, Nicklas worked on a variety of exciting projects. He conducted service jobs, training sessions, worked on Essegi Storage Solutions, learned about soldering robots, and delved into Yamaha equipment’s user interface.
These hands-on experiences have given him a broad skillset, ideal for supporting clients and internal teams alike.
